Security Officer 42hrs - Treaty Centre, Hounslow

Purpose of the Role

The Security Officer reports to the Site Security Manager regarding the overall support and delivery of security on site. On a day-to-day basis, however, task allocation is managed by the Security Controllers or Team Leader as defined by the site.

You will ensure exemplary standards of security and customer service are consistently provided to both clients and visitors. As the public face of the security team, professionalism is essential at all times. A can-do attitude is crucial in this influential role.


Key Responsibilities

  • Be part of a team in a roster pattern
  • Ready interaction with all visitors and tenants, delivering a world-class customer-focused service
  • Conduct regular patrols of the centre as directed, following a proactive security strategy
  • Ensure compliance with company procedures, centre processes, and external regulatory bodies
  • Provide a timely response to all security incidents and events
  • Maintain professionalism, politeness, courtesy, and helpfulness at all times
  • Adhere to strict uniform requirements and uphold exemplary personal grooming standards
  • Proactively assist visitors, offering support where opportunities arise
  • Ensure the centre remains safe and non-threatening for all individuals
  • Manage incidents in accordance with company policies and procedures
  • Liaise with Security Controllers and Site Security Manager, coordinating responses and supporting colleagues
  • Efficiently handle emergencies, including fires and bomb scares, keeping the team and clients updated
  • Demonstrate intelligent understanding of human behaviour, monitoring/surveilling suspicious individuals while logging and reporting incidents accurately
  • Prevent unauthorised access by banned persons
  • Assist third parties or contractors, ensuring adherence to company policies
  • Maintain continuous monitoring of centre radio systems with correct procedures
  • Oversee and update incident and health & safety records
  • Liaise regularly with management, providing feedback, implementing solutions, and promoting process improvements
  • Report any security-related issues that may impair safety to the Site Security Manager
  • Support internal/external audits as required
  • Embed continuous improvement within security delivery
  • Perform additional duties as needed for business operations
  • Work in the security control room once fully trained
  • Act as an ambassador for the centre and security team

Requirements

Skills, Knowledge, and Experience

  • Strong verbal & written communication skills
  • Ability to articulate clearly with senior management/colleagues
  • Outgoing personality with a customer-centric approach
  • Self-sufficiency in unsupervised work
  • Calm under pressure, ensuring quick decision-making
  • Smart appearance aligned with company standards
  • Flexibility and adaptability across shift timings

Qualifications and Experience (Essential)

  • Valid SIA Frontline & CCTV licences
  • Experience in a customer-focused security or service role
  • Five-year checkable employment record
  • First Aid at Work certification (or willingness to undertake)
  • AED (Automated External Defibrillator) training (desirable)

Working Arrangements

  • Hours: 42 hours per week
  • Rota: 4 on-duty shifts, 4 off
  • Shift Type: Mix of day and night rotations

Remuneration

  • £14.50 per hour
